Who is Holly Willoughby (Biography/Personal Details)

Holly Marie Willoughby is an English television presenter, model, and author born on February 10, 1981, in Brighton, East Sussex, England.

She is best known for her long‑running co‑presenter roles on ITV shows such as This Morning and Dancing on Ice.

Willoughby began her career in the late 1990s after being spotted by talent scouts at age 14 and signing with Storm Model Management.

She has also worked as a model for teen magazines and brands, appearing in publications targeted at young audiences.

Holly has become one of the UK’s most recognisable daytime TV personalities, earning multiple awards and nominations for her presenting work.

In addition to television, she is an author of parenting and children’s books, often co‑writing with her sister.

She has served as a brand ambassador for major companies such as Marks & Spencer and Garnier.

Willoughby is known for her warm, relatable presenting style and strong connection with UK audiences.

She worked on children’s programs early in her career before moving into mainstream entertainment presenting.

Over more than two decades in television, she has become a style and media influence figure in British pop culture.


Early Life Highlights of Holly Willoughby (Background/Childhood)

Holly Willoughby was born to Brian Willoughby, a sales manager, and Linda (née Fleming), a former air stewardess, in Brighton, East Sussex.





She was raised in Woodmancote, West Sussex, and attended the independent Burgess Hill Girls school.

Willoughby later continued her education at The College of Richard Collyer in Horsham.

At age 14, she was discovered by scouts at The Clothes Show Live and signed with a modelling agency.

During her teens, she appeared in teen magazines and modelled for brands such as Pretty Polly.

Her early exposure to the media gave her confidence and familiarity with audiences long before mainstream TV.

Willoughby has spoken about being shy at school and having to push herself out of her comfort zone during early modelling experiences.

She grew up with an older sister, Kelly, with whom she remains close and later co‑authored books.

Early performance and appearance opportunities helped shape her comfort in front of cameras.

Childhood interests such as drama and presentation laid the groundwork for her future television career.


Current Life Highlights of Holly Willoughby (Career/Other Work)

Holly Willoughby co‑presented ITV’s This Morning for 14 years, becoming a staple of British daytime television.

She has also co‑hosted Dancing on Ice on multiple occasions across its run.

Willoughby has appeared on panel shows such as Celebrity Juice and game shows including Play to the Whistle.

Her career expanded to presenting specials like The Voice UK and Surprise Surprise, showcasing her versatility.





In recent years, she launched a wellness and lifestyle brand, extending her influence beyond television.

Holly is also an author, with books ranging from parenting guides to children’s fiction.

She serves as a brand ambassador for major commercial partners, enhancing her media presence.

After stepping down from This Morning in 2023 amid personal safety concerns, she has pursued new TV roles and projects into 2025.

Her work beyond presenting includes podcasts and public speaking engagements on wellness and balance.

Willoughby’s media presence includes significant social media engagement and fashion influence in the UK.


Personal Life Highlights of Holly Willoughby (List of Romantic Relationships/List of Family Members)

Holly Willoughby married TV producer Dan Baldwin on August 4, 2007, after meeting on the set of a children’s show.

The couple have three children together: Harry James, Belle, and Chester William Baldwin.

Willoughby and her husband share a close family life, often keeping details of their children’s lives private.

Her older sister Kelly is a successful author and frequent collaborator on children’s books.

Holly has described balancing motherhood with a television career as one of her biggest challenges and joys.

She has spoken openly about her dyslexia and how it has shaped her approach to work.

Family support was a factor in her decision to step back from This Morning for safety and wellbeing reasons.





Willoughby and her husband’s home was targeted in the thwarted plot against her, leading to increased security measures.

Her parents raised her alongside her sister in West Sussex, fostering a grounded upbringing.
